"09" Lobster Season?


Who knows the starting date of the 2009 lobster season here in Baja?

It varies by area...they started already in some areas. Here in Asuncion it starts the 1st of October but I think they started in the GN lagoon already because they close the season during whale season.

we saw the lobster boats from Bahia Tortugas out working today...they started lobster season Sept.15.
Luckily our area has always been serious about protecting their product and adhere to the limits and are very very strict about not taking undersize and poaching.

doesnt matter if they are in or out of season...if they are small, they are illegal...in a perfect world, we would say no thank you and explain in a nice way that we support conservation of the species and indicate that they are undersize....smiling all the while.

but sometimes if they are already dead...the fisherman will gift them to someone he likes instead of throwing them away.

Here the coop makes fishermen measure each suspect small lobster and will fine them if there is a small one in their catch.
